Business Analyst

Full time at a Laimoon Verified Company in Qatar
Posted on August 28, 2024

Job details

The ideal candidate is a team player who will be responsible for working with company data in various business areas. Specific responsibilities include reporting metrics, analyzing methodologies, suggesting operation improvements, and building proposal evaluations in a cross-functional environment.

Responsibilities

Conduct process mapping, AS-IS process analysis, and TO-BE process design to optimize operational efficiency.

Document business requirements specifications (BRS) and lead ERP implementation projects.

Evaluate ERP systems and conduct user acceptance tests, identifying gaps between delivered software and initial requirements.

Lead process excellence initiatives with measurable outcomes across business units.

Generate statistical reports on managed tasks and develop visual management systems for monitoring KPIs.

Monitor critical KPIs against targets, provide regular status reports, manage risks, and escalate issues when necessary.

Required experience

Proven experience in process management and ERP implementation, with a focus on Oracle products preferred.

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to create compelling content.

Proficiency in reporting tools such as Power BI and Oracle BI.

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Excel for data management and analysis, including complex spreadsheet and model creation.

Strong analytical skills and the ability to make data-driven decisions.

Creative problem-solving abilities and a passion for developing innovative digitalization strategies.

Ability to work effectively both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.

Qualifications

Education & Professional Qualification:

Relevant business degree in Process or Supply Chain Management.

Green Belt or Black Belt certified

Globally recognized Project Management certification

Professional Experience:

Logistics or Maritime experience. Ideally from a leading company in the region and with knowledge in Feeder, NVOCC or Freight forwarding & container management

Hands-on experience in Oracle modules (from either implementation or operation or both)

Other preferred qualifications

6+ years extensive experience using leading business improvement methodologies and processes (e.g., Lean/Six Sigma, PMP or similar)

Demonstrated Project Governance experience

Cross-Functional experience and / or Management Consulting experience a plus

Market Knowlegde:

Knowledge of market leading practices and Logistics processes, tools of process excellence and optimization

Excellent planning and organizational skills.

Result driven.

Excellent relationship building skills. Ability to effectively influence key decision makers at all levels of management. Collaborative mind-set when engaging cross-functional teams and outside stakeholders.

Knowledge of the shipping, logistics, and energy industries is preferred
